Travel Documents and Requirements for Mexico
When considering travel to Mexico, a common question arises: Do I Need A Visa To Go To Mexico? The answer largely depends on your nationality and current residency status. For residents of Canada, the United States, Japan, the United Kingdom, and countries in the Schengen Area, a visa is typically not required, provided you have a valid passport and meet other immigration criteria. This eligibility extends to individuals holding a valid visa from any of these regions when visiting Mexico for tourism, business, or transit.
Speaking from over two decades in the travel documentation industry with GovAssist, I've seen firsthand how travelers often overlook the importance of ensuring that both their passport and any visa documents maintain validity throughout their entire stay. Airlines can sometimes impose stricter requirements than those of the destination country, potentially leading to travel complications. Thus, it's crucial for every traveler to double-check with their airline regarding boarding rules and document validity.
Besides the usual visa queries, it's vital to note that cruise passengers visiting Mexico's ports do not require a visa, provided they hold a valid passport. It seems like a small detail, but it's significant for those planning leisure trips via sea routes. Common Concerns and Solutions for Traveling to Mexico
Even with all the information available, travelers still face a series of common concerns about the need for visas to go to Mexico. One particular worry is whether or not traveling with children alters the documentation requirements. From personal experience, it's crucial to carry a notarized letter of consent if one parent is traveling solo with a child, simplifying any customs inquiries.
Another frequent concern involves last-minute travel plans. At GovAssist, we've successfully expedited travel documentation for numerous clients facing tight timelines. The secret lies in maintaining a structured documentation checklist to prevent missing any critical requirements during hurried preparations.
Our clients often ask if holding dual citizenship affects their need for a visa to Mexico. Dual citizens can typically use either passport for travel, but it's essential to ensure the chosen passport aligns with the visa-free requirements or has the appropriate visas.

What factors contribute to the strength of a passport and how does it impact global mobility?
The strength of a passport fundamentally lies in its ability to grant the holder entry to many countries with minimal travel restrictions, often visa-free or with visa-on-arrival privileges. This global mobility is a significant advantage because it simplifies travel logistics, reduces costs, and fosters personal and professional opportunities. For instance, someone with a strong passport, like those from Japan or Singapore, can travel to numerous countries for business meetings or vacations without the hassle of visa applications.
Countries with strong passports usually have robust diplomatic ties and mutual trust with other nations. This often reflects their geopolitical stability, efficient governance, and economic prosperity, which are critical factors for securing bilateral agreements that enhance global mobility.
